Encircled flux (EF) is a metric that specifies how optical power is distributed across the core of a multimode fiber. It defines the integral of power output over the fiber radius, setting limits for the amount of optical power within a specified radius of the fiber core . EF ensures that the launch conditions of light into the fiber are consistent, which is critical for accurate bandwidth simulation and loss testing. An underfilled fiber has more power concentrated near the core center, while an overfilled fiber distributes more power toward the outer regions of the core. EF was initially developed for 10 Gigabit Ethernet to model ideal VCSEL sources and later adopted for loss testing to replace older, less precise methods .

Encircled flux is the industry-standard method for defining mode fill in multimode fiber, ensuring that optical loss measurements are consistent and repeatable. It is integrated into major standards like TIA-568.3-D and ISO/IEC 11801, and its proper implementation is critical for accurate fiber optic testing and network reliability .
